How Long Does a Bitcoin Peer-to-Peer Transfer Take? A Comprehensive Guide333
Bitcoin's peer-to-peer (P2P) nature is a cornerstone of its decentralized design. Unlike traditional banking systems, Bitcoin transactions don't rely on intermediaries like banks or payment processors. This direct transfer between users promises faster and potentially cheaper transactions. However, the time it takes for a Bitcoin P2P transfer to complete isn't a fixed number. Several factors influence the speed, ranging from network congestion to the user's chosen confirmation threshold. Understanding these factors is crucial for anyone using Bitcoin.
The most common misunderstanding regarding Bitcoin transaction speed is conflating "transaction broadcast" with "transaction confirmation." When you initiate a Bitcoin P2P transfer, your transaction is first *broadcast* to the Bitcoin network. This broadcast, typically taking only a few seconds, signifies that your transaction is in the queue to be included in a block. However, the transaction isn't considered complete until it's included in a block and receives a certain number of confirmations.
The time it takes for a transaction to be confirmed depends primarily on the network's processing power and the transaction fee you pay. Bitcoin miners, who validate transactions and add them to blocks, prioritize transactions with higher fees. This is because miners are incentivized to include transactions that offer the highest reward (transaction fees plus the block reward). Therefore, a higher transaction fee generally results in faster confirmation times.
Here's a breakdown of the typical timeframes involved:
1. Transaction Broadcast (Near Instantaneous): Once you initiate the transaction using your Bitcoin wallet, it's almost immediately broadcast to the Bitcoin network. This usually takes only a few seconds. Your transaction will then propagate across the network through peer-to-peer communication.
2. Transaction Inclusion in a Block (Variable): This is where the variability comes in. The time it takes for a transaction to be included in a block depends on several factors:
Network Congestion: When the Bitcoin network is heavily congested (many transactions vying for inclusion in blocks), confirmation times can increase significantly. During periods of high activity or market volatility, it might take longer for your transaction to be confirmed.
Transaction Fee: As mentioned earlier, higher transaction fees incentivize miners to include your transaction in the next block they mine. Lower fees mean your transaction might have to wait longer in the mempool (the pool of unconfirmed transactions).
Mining Difficulty: The difficulty of mining Bitcoin blocks adjusts dynamically to maintain a consistent block generation time of approximately 10 minutes. A higher difficulty means it takes longer for miners to solve the complex cryptographic puzzle and add a new block to the blockchain.
3. Confirmation Threshold (Variable): While a transaction is technically valid after inclusion in a block, most users and businesses wait for multiple confirmations to ensure greater security and reduce the risk of transaction reversal. A single confirmation is generally sufficient for smaller transactions, while larger transactions often require more. Common confirmation thresholds include:
1 Confirmation: Provides a basic level of security but is still susceptible to potential reversal (though highly unlikely).
6 Confirmations: Widely considered a sufficient level of confirmation for most transactions, offering a high degree of security against reversal.
12 Confirmations: Offers even greater security and is preferred for extremely high-value transactions.
Therefore, a realistic timeframe for a Bitcoin P2P transfer to be considered complete ranges from minutes to hours, depending on the factors outlined above. In ideal conditions with a high transaction fee, you might see confirmation within minutes. However, during periods of high network congestion, it could take significantly longer.
Strategies for Faster Transactions:
Use a Higher Transaction Fee: This is the most effective way to speed up your transaction. Many wallets provide fee estimations, allowing you to select a fee based on your desired speed.
Monitor Transaction Status: Your Bitcoin wallet should provide updates on your transaction's status, including its confirmation count. You can also use blockchain explorers to independently track your transaction.
Choose the Right Wallet: Different Bitcoin wallets offer varying levels of fee control and transaction management capabilities. Some wallets offer features that help you estimate and optimize transaction fees.
Be Patient: While you can take steps to expedite transactions, it's essential to be patient and understand that network congestion is sometimes unavoidable.
In conclusion, the time it takes for a Bitcoin peer-to-peer transfer to complete is not fixed. It’s a dynamic process influenced by network conditions, transaction fees, and the desired level of confirmation. While instantaneous broadcast is common, the confirmation process can take anywhere from minutes to hours. By understanding these factors and employing appropriate strategies, users can manage their expectations and ensure their Bitcoin transactions are processed efficiently and securely.
2025-03-29
Previous:Understanding and Troubleshooting “OK, Withdrawal Closed“ in Cryptocurrency
Next:Ada vs. EOS: A Deep Dive into Two Leading Blockchain Platforms

Shiba Inu (SHIB) Listing on Binance: A Deep Dive into the Implications
https://cryptoswiki.com/cryptocoins/69495.html

Is USDC Posing a Systemic Risk to DeFi? A Deep Dive into the Circle-backed Stablecoin
https://cryptoswiki.com/cryptocoins/69494.html

Bitcoin Price Cycles: Understanding the Past to Predict the Future?
https://cryptoswiki.com/cryptocoins/69493.html

USDC: A Deep Dive into the USD-Pegged Stablecoin
https://cryptoswiki.com/cryptocoins/69492.html

How to Buy Bitcoin (BTC) in 2024: A Comprehensive Guide
https://cryptoswiki.com/cryptocoins/69491.html
Hot

Tether to Bitcoin Transfers: A Comprehensive Guide for Beginners and Experts
https://cryptoswiki.com/cryptocoins/68957.html

OKX Earn: A Deep Dive into its Crypto Staking and Lending Products
https://cryptoswiki.com/cryptocoins/68940.html

OKX Wallet: A Deep Dive into Security, Features, and Usability
https://cryptoswiki.com/cryptocoins/67705.html

Bitcoin Price Analysis: Navigating Volatility in the July 10th Market
https://cryptoswiki.com/cryptocoins/67691.html

Investing in China‘s Bitcoin Ecosystem: Understanding the Indirect Exposure
https://cryptoswiki.com/cryptocoins/67560.html